[lojban-beginners] Re: Logical connectives for multiple sumti within a single bridi
As John Cowan, himself, has answered in the IRC, {mi .a do nelci ti .u ta} is
equivalent to:
{mi nelci ti .iju mi nelci ta .ija tu'e do nelci ti .iju do nelci ta
[tu'u]},
in other words, it equals a cross product of both compound
sumti, where {.a} has greater scope than {.u}.
As John has explained,the left-most sumti connective has wider scope over the next,
following the general rule about predominance of the left.
